/*
 * Firmware update channel for the Ostrel M4 sensor line.
 * These constants govern rollout pacing: batch size per wave,
 * health-check dwell time, and abort thresholds. Values were
 * retuned after the stalled wave-3 rollout discussed at last
 * week's sync; the dwell time now exceeds worst-case device
 * reboot latency. The active tuning constants follow.
 */

constants for tageg-kagag:
QUOTAS = {
    "kelax": 495,
    "istath": 366,
    "tammir": 108,
    "novdor": 730,
    "casax": 816,
    "quenael": 874,
    "pelius": 403,
}

# This block configures the client for the Furrowlink telemetry
# gateway, which aggregates readings from tractor-mounted sensors
# across the Hollowbrook test farms. The gateway enforces strict
# per-client rate limits (60 req/min), so do not lower the polling
# interval without coordinating with the Furrowlink team. Retries
# use exponential backoff; changing this risks duplicate ingestion.
# Authentication uses a static internal service key, provided here.

app token of kajeg-hafop = kto7_tzVv3xY

MEMO — Kettling Depot Receiving

Uniform sets for the new Kettling depot arrive Wednesday via Ashgrove courier: 40 boxes, sorted by size, manifest attached to box one. Check the count at the dock before signing; shortages go straight to stores, not the courier. The hand-over instruction the courier will follow is set out below.

drop instructions, tafof-baguf: the holmir gilox courier leaves the sormir ulaok holdor ledger at gate 5596 under passcode 257343